Call of Duty: Black Ops 7 & Beyond – Recap from Call of Duty: NEXT

Time: 2025-10-17

As the official launch of Call of Duty: Black Ops 7 (Nov 14) draws near, Treyarch took center stage at Call of Duty: NEXT to break down Multiplayer, Zombies, and Call of Duty: Warzone updates. Plus, Call of Duty: Mobile turns 6, the Call of Duty Endowment (C.O.D.E.) Bowl VI heats up, and the World Series of Warzone Global Finals is here—here’s your full recap.

  1. Call of Duty: NEXT Showcase
    Ahead of Black Ops 7’s Nov 14 launch, Call of Duty: NEXT let creators and devs play the new game and dive into key features for Multiplayer, Zombies, and Warzone.
    Devs also previewed Warzone’s upcoming content: the Haven’s Hollow Resurgence map, new Signal Station POI, and remastered Factory POI (coming to Verdansk). The event also covered Mobile’s 6th anniversary, C.O.D.E. Bowl VI competition, and more.

  2. Black Ops 7 Multiplayer
    Hosts Miles Ross and Stephanie Snowden were joined by Treyarch devs (Matt Scronce, Yale Miller, et al.) to break down Multiplayer maps, modes, and new features. Footage showed 6 new maps, multiple modes (including the all-new Overload), and weapons—all playable in the Beta.
    Set in 2035, the game blends new tech with classic Black Ops style. Devs walked through map design, Loadouts, progression, and movement changes, highlighting how fresh gameplay and near-future elements tie into Multiplayer.
    2.1 Map Design: Classic 3-Lane Style, Vibrant Locations
    The event focused on 6 of 18 launch maps—all playable in the Beta: Blackheart, Cortex, Exposure, Forge, Imprint, Toshin.
    Treyarch’s vision: fast, frenetic gameplay on vibrant, narrative-driven maps (classic 3-lane design). To boost pacing, more standard-sized maps let players clash head-on or flank.
    Launch maps span diverse, story-linked locations:
    Covert Guild facilities in Japan
    David Mason’s childhood cabin (Alaskan wilderness)
    High-tech solar array (Australian Outback)
    Footage showed matches of Team Deathmatch, Domination, Hardpoint, and Overload—leaning into tight, cover-to-cover gameplay core to Black Ops.
    More at Launch: Beyond Core Multiplayer, the new 20v20 Skirmish mode arrives with 2 large maps. Traverse via armored vehicles, ATVs, grapple, or wingsuit—adding new ways to reach objectives.
    2.2 New Game Mode: Overload (Beta + Launch)
    Overload pits teams against each other to control the Overload Device—pick it up and carry it to one of the enemy’s 2 control zones.
    The device’s position is visible on HUD/Tac-Map.
    Carriers get extra intel.
    The device swaps hands in intense back-and-forth; winning means protecting your carrier to overload the enemy.
    Beta players can try Overload, plus Team Deathmatch, Hardpoint, Kill Confirmed, Hardcore, and surprises.
    2.3 Next-Level Omnimovement
    Black Ops 7 polishes Black Ops 6’s Omnimovement system—fast, fluid action with new tweaks:
    Wall Jump: Propel over gaps or reach higher surfaces. Chain up to 3 jumps (each shortens momentum/distance). Some maps have deadly drops—wall jumps are needed to survive.
    Movement Speed Adjustments: Tac Sprint is off by default; all Operators get higher base speed. Want Tac Sprint? Unlock it via a Multiplayer Perk. Customize further with Perks like Lightweight, Dexterity, Gung Ho.
